Stray Kids also known as SKZ, is a South Korean boy group debuted in 2018 under JYP Entertainment, formed through the survival show of the same name. It consists of 8 members: Bang Chan, Lee Know, Changbin, Hyunjin, HAN, Felix, Seungmin and I.N, with former member Woojin having left the group in 2019.
Stray Kids' music tackles the problem of self identity. They successfully conveyed a self-identity journey, from the raw and gritty energy of youths running towards an uncertain future, to a newfound (sometimes mischievous) confidence freely enjoying the present. Since debut, they convey this journey by pouring raps and vocals over a wide range of genres rooted in EDM, rock, and hip-hop, performing assertive choreographies, and using witty wordplays; all of these elements combining into the "Stray Kids" genre.

Hyunjin (현진) was born on March 20, 2000 (age 24) in Seoul, South Korea. He is a dancer, rapper and visual of Stray Kids. He is part of the group's sub-unit DANCERACHA. Read more >

I am WHO is Stray Kids' second mini album, with "My Pace" serving as the title track. It was released digitally and physically on August 6, 2018 by JYP Entertainment. The album sold 79,684 copies in the first month. Read more >
